Motive is looking for a Physics Programmer to join our team.

As a Physics Programmer you will work closely with designers, tech artists and the rest of the programming team to guide the application of physics and destructions in the game and extend the engines capabilities. Working on an ambitious Iron Man project you will play an important part in bringing the gameplay experience and environments to life.

What the Physics Developer will do at Motive:
• Be an expert in the engine's physics capabilities, working closely with the animation, design, tech art to optimally use the feature set for gameplay and world building.
• Inspire technical innovation and improve the physics engines capabilities
• Work closely with QA and technical leadership to ensure the stability and accuracy of physics systems by identifying, communicating, and resolving defects
• Lead and participate in design and code reviews
• Investigate and adopt new game technologies, practices, tools, and systems

Who You Are:
• B.S. (or higher) degree in Computer Science or equivalent
• 6+ years of professional C/C++ experience
• Excellent math skills
• Experience with advanced physics tools/middleware such as Havok and Chaos
• Familiarity with advanced game engines like Unreal, Unity and others
• Experience applying physics technology to character features and world building
• Experience developing complex physics based systems for published PC or current gen console games with at least one shipped title
• Knowledge of C# is an asset
